Output 7091609f73fcf17d99288ea6d78da06dc9536f3959b5135f0ccdac66763eb9c6:2

value
2114388
script pubkey
OP_0 OP_PUSHBYTES_20 3d4f2378957f7e29cee119244671ed159aa786a5
address
ltc1q848jx7y40alznnhpryjyvu0dzkd20p49wvzujn
transaction
7091609f73fcf17d99288ea6d78da06dc9536f3959b5135f0ccdac66763eb9c6
spent
true